瑞盟MS8422從模式 當(dāng)串行端口處于從模式時(shí),它的左/右時(shí)鐘(ILRCK,OLRCK1或OLRCK2),和它的串行位時(shí)鐘(ISCLK,OSCLK1或OSCLK2)作為輸入。如果串行輸入或串行輸出在數(shù)據(jù)路徑上有SRC的 話,那么串行端口的LRCK和SCLK可能和其他所有串行端口異步。左/右時(shí)鐘應(yīng)該連續(xù),但是如 果在相應(yīng)的LRCK相位中有足夠的串行時(shí)鐘采樣所有的數(shù)據(jù)位,時(shí)鐘的占空比可以小于50%。 在左對(duì)齊和I2S模式的半個(gè)LRCK周期中,如果SCLK周期比所需的少,那么數(shù)據(jù)會(huì)從從LSB位 開始縮短。在右對(duì)齊模式中,數(shù)據(jù)將會(huì)無效。 在從模式中,如果串行音頻輸出直接來源AES3接收器或不使用采樣轉(zhuǎn)換器的串行輸入端口,那么提供給串行音頻輸出端口的OLRCK應(yīng)該與Fsi或ILRCK同步,以避免跳過部分采樣值或重復(fù) 采樣。OSLIP位(“中斷狀態(tài)(14h)”)指示是否跳過采樣值或重復(fù)采樣。 如果輸入采樣值 Fsi 或 ILRCK 大于從模式下的 OLRCK 的頻率,將會(huì)減少采樣。如果 Fsi 或ILRCK 小于從模式的 OLRCK 頻率,將會(huì)重復(fù)采樣。任何一種方式都會(huì)使 OSLIP 設(shè)置為 1,并且直到從控制端口讀取后才清零。 MS8422N硬件模式控制在硬件模式中,不能使用串行音頻輸入端口。SDOUT1是來自采樣轉(zhuǎn)換器的串行數(shù)據(jù)輸出,SDOUT2是直接來自AES3接收器的串行音頻輸出。由于在硬件模式中不存在串行音頻輸入,所有 的音頻數(shù)據(jù)都是通過AES3接收器輸入的。在硬件模式中,串行音頻輸出端口由SAOF和MS_SEL管腳控制。詳見“硬件模式串行音頻端口控制”。 在硬件模式中,當(dāng)一個(gè)串行端口設(shè)置為主模式時(shí),每個(gè) LRCK 周期都會(huì)有 64 個(gè) SCLK。 MS8422軟件模式控制在軟件模式中,MS8422N 提供了一個(gè)串行音頻輸入端口和兩個(gè)串行音頻輸出端口。每個(gè)串行 端口的時(shí)鐘和數(shù)據(jù)路徑選項(xiàng)都是可配置的,參考寄存器串行音頻輸入數(shù)據(jù)格式(0Bh)、 TI德州儀器 LM358 雙運(yùn)算放大器。 MIX3901 內(nèi)置升壓立體聲防破音F類音頻功放。 |